I never saw myself loving weightlifting. In fact, the only reason I picked it up was because my brother in law couldn't fit his bench press and weights in his new place and it fit very nicely in my garage. I needed an exercise and a gym wasn't an option. I was 6 months post partum after having my second child. I topped out at 190 lbs before I gave birth. I decided to give it a try. My mom warned me that I should never lift over 50 lbs. At first, her warning affected me. Made me doubt what I was doing. But, I was never a good listener when it came to my mother. I kept going.

I started with 1200 calories. I kept telling myself how awesome I felt, even when hunger pangs hit me at work or I'd down it with water when I could. Then, I found the forums here. It was a fountain of information (and misinformation if you're not careful). My eyes opened. I discovered women got sexy from lifting heavy and that I could eat more than 1200 and lose! My mind exploded. I switched it up to 1550. I became less angry and tired. Now, I eat close to 1800 and lose. I use the philosophy of iifym as my ground. I eat ice cream and flaming hot cheetos before bed while I play video games.

I also lift over 50 lbs now in all my lifts. I just hit a new 1 RM goal of being able to Squat my body weight. I want to test myself. Now that I'm at the end of just "losing weight", I've fallen for that big rack in my garage. The one I go out to 4x a week in -12 degree weather to test myself. Because my journey doesn't end when a number on a scale tells me. Fitness and health is life long. What started as a goal to hit a certain number has evolved into something incredible. I hope everyone can feel that passion for what they do, in everything in life.

    You look amazing!!! What exactly was your exercise routine to get such awesome results? Did you also do cardio, or just lifting?
  • SugaryLynx
    SugaryLynx Posts: 2,640 Member
    You look amazing!!! What exactly was your exercise routine to get such awesome results? Did you also do cardio, or just lifting?

    Thank you! I'm doing Wendler's 5 / 3 / 1 routine. I do some minor cardio. About 30 minutes 4x a week Just Dance 2014 on my PS4. Before that I would walk when I could. The one thing I've kept consistent was my lifting.
